How to Find Good Restaurants Near Me

When searching for Restaurants Near Me, the closest result is not necessarily the best choice.
Distance matters, especially when you are already hungry, but it should be only one part of the decision. Look at the type of food, recent customer experiences, menu, price range, atmosphere, and whether the restaurant actually suits the occasion.
A quick lunch and an anniversary dinner clearly need different places.

Start With What You Feel Like Eating

This sounds obvious, yet it saves a surprising amount of time.
Do you want pizza? Curry? Burgers? Pasta? Sushi? Steak? Something light? Something spicy?
Narrowing the cuisine first can immediately reduce a long list of restaurants to a manageable handful.
If you genuinely have no preference, think about the style of meal instead. Maybe you want somewhere casual where you can walk in wearing trainers. Perhaps you want table service and a slower evening.
Sometimes you do not know what you want until you rule out what you definitely do not want.

Read Recent Reviews, Not Just the Rating

A high star rating is useful, but it does not tell the whole story.
A restaurant with thousands of reviews and a slightly lower score may be more reliable than somewhere with five perfect ratings.
More importantly, read what recent customers actually say.
Look for repeated comments about food quality, service, cleanliness, portion size, waiting times, and value.
One bad review should not necessarily put you off. Every restaurant occasionally has a difficult evening.
Patterns matter more.
If recent customers repeatedly mention cold food, long waits, or incorrect orders, pay attention.

Look for Reviews About the Dish You Want

Suppose you are considering a restaurant mainly because you want a burger.
Reviews about its breakfast or desserts are not especially useful.
Search through comments for the dishes you are considering. Customers often mention specific meals they loved or would avoid ordering again.
You may even discover the restaurant is known for something completely different from what first caught your attention.

Customer Photos Can Be More Helpful Than Menu Photos

Professional food photography is supposed to make dishes look irresistible.
Customer photos are usually less polished but more revealing.
They can show realistic portion sizes, presentation, seating, lighting, and how crowded the restaurant becomes.
If 10 customers upload photos of the same dish and they all look consistently good, that is encouraging.
Photos are also useful when atmosphere matters.
You can quickly tell whether a restaurant feels casual, romantic, family-friendly, lively, cramped, formal, or somewhere between all of those.

Check the Menu Before You Leave

There is nothing worse than arriving somewhere with a group and discovering that half the table cannot find anything they want.
Take a quick look at the menu first.
You do not need to plan every bite, but check the basics.
Are there enough options?
Does the price range fit your budget?
Are vegetarian or dietary choices available if someone needs them?
Does the restaurant mainly serve small plates, large meals, or something more casual?
A minute spent checking beforehand can prevent an awkward discussion in the doorway.

Independent Restaurants or Familiar Chains?

Both can be good choices.
Independent restaurants often offer something distinctive. Recipes may reflect the owner’s background, local ingredients, family traditions, or a particular cooking style.
Chains offer familiarity.
Sometimes you want to know exactly what your meal will taste like before you arrive.

Why Local Restaurants Are Worth Exploring

Independent restaurants can introduce you to dishes you would not normally order.
A small family-run place might have a short menu because it focuses on doing a few things well.
That can be a very good sign.
Local restaurants also tend to develop regular customers. If you walk into a place and the staff clearly knows several diners, somebody is probably doing something right.
It does not guarantee an amazing meal, but it is a nice clue.

When a Chain Makes Sense

Chains can be useful when eating with a group.
Menus are generally predictable, dietary information may be easier to find, and people often already know what they like.
They can also be useful while traveling.
After a long day, discovering an exciting local restaurant can be a great way to end the day. Other times, you want something familiar without thinking too hard.
Both choices are completely reasonable.

Is a Busy Restaurant Always a Good Sign?

Usually, a restaurant being busy is encouraging.
People are choosing to eat there.
Regular turnover can also mean ingredients are being used consistently rather than sitting around.
But popularity brings another issue: waiting.
If a restaurant is known to be crowded on Friday evenings, check whether reservations are available.
A fantastic meal may not feel quite as fantastic after standing outside hungry for an hour.

Sometimes Quieter Times Are Better

Try popular restaurants slightly outside peak periods.
An early dinner or later lunch can be more relaxed.
Staff may have more time, tables are easier to find, and the whole experience feels less rushed.
If you are visiting mainly to enjoy the restaurant rather than eat and leave, timing matters.

Don’t Judge a Restaurant Only by Its Interior

Beautiful design can make a restaurant memorable.
Plants hanging from ceilings, exposed brick, neon signs, carefully arranged lighting. It all photographs well.
But none of it improves an overcooked meal.
Some excellent restaurants are visually quite ordinary.
Sometimes the plastic chairs and slightly dated menu hide food people have been returning for 20 years to eat.
Of course, cleanliness and comfort matter.
The point is simply that fashionable design and good cooking are not the same thing.

Takeaway or Eat In?

Sometimes you want restaurant food without the restaurant part.
That is completely fair.
Takeaway works particularly well for foods that travel easily, such as pizza, curry, rice dishes, noodles, burgers, and many grilled foods.
Other meals are best eaten immediately.
Anything that depends on crisp texture can suffer in a takeaway container.
Fries have a particularly short window between wonderful and slightly sad.

Consider the Journey

If you are ordering from a restaurant far away, think about how the food will travel.
A dish that tastes amazing straight from the kitchen may not be designed to spend forty minutes in a delivery bag.
Closer is sometimes better for takeaway, even when another restaurant has slightly stronger reviews.

Dietary Requirements Deserve a Quick Check

If you have dietary restrictions, checking beforehand is worth the effort.
Menus may label vegetarian, vegan, gluten-free, halal, or allergen-related options, but practices vary between restaurants.
If avoiding a particular ingredient is medically important, contact the restaurant directly rather than assuming a menu symbol tells you everything.
For preference-based diets, menus usually provide enough information to decide whether a place suits you.
The key is checking before everyone gets hungry.

Finding Restaurants While Traveling

Searching for Restaurants Near Me becomes especially useful in an unfamiliar town or city.
Tourist areas usually offer plenty of options, but the busiest street is not always where the most interesting food is hiding.
Walk a little farther.
Residential areas, markets, side streets, and neighborhoods outside major attractions often feature restaurants that primarily serve local customers.
That can mean better value and a more interesting experience.

Ask Where Locals Actually Eat

Hotel staff and shop workers can be useful sources of recommendations.
But phrase the question carefully.
Instead of asking, “What is the best restaurant around here?” ask, “Where do you go for dinner?”
Those questions can produce very different answers.
The famous restaurant may be where visitors are sent.
The tiny place three streets away may be where everyone who lives nearby actually eats.
